Ordinals
beta
Sat 795657297059673
decimal
159131.2297059673
degree
0°159131′1883″2297059673‴
percentile
37.888442758804594%
name
iffabqgzkjg
cycle
0
epoch
0
period
78
block
159131
offset
2297059673
timestamp
2011-12-26 00:34:24 UTC
rarity
common
prev
next